Old early map of Canada, Louisbourg, N. S., Nova Scotia.

Created by Emanuel Bowen in 1752.
  • Relief shown pictorially.
  • Includes index.
  • One of 13 maps in the atlas plate "Particular draughts and plans of some of the principal towns and harbours belonging to the English, French, and Spaniards, in America and West Indies".
